Members, friends and families of New Acropolis Colaba (Main Centre) in partnership with local organisation My Dream Colaba spent a good part of their weekends on 2nd & 3rd April 2016 beautifying a neglected wall in the Cuffe Parade area.

Over 25 volunteers spent time plastering and repairing the worn down wall before painting it with the message of “Harmony” in English and Marathi. Harmony denotes the importance of a well-balanced, peaceful, symbiotic relationship as an important ingredient for the survival and well-being of our society.

This was the second such beautification drive undertaken by New Acropolis after the success of painting a wall with the message of “Hope”, also in Colaba. The underlying aim of such activities, is to bring about awareness of being responsible citizens, by caring for the communities we live in.
